Completing NRCME Certification Is As Easy As 1, 2, 3!

  1. Register with the NRCME and get your unique identifier number.
  2. Complete an accredited NRCME Training Course and print your certificate of completion.
  3. Schedule to sit for the Certification Exam at a Certification Testing Center.

What is a DOT medical examination report?

The DOT medical exam looks for certain pre-existing medical conditions that might impair a driver’s ability to safely operate a commercial motor vehicle. A medical examiner’s certificate, which is commonly known as a DOT medical card, provides proof the driver has meet the medical requirements to hold a CDL.

How long is DOT certification?

24 months
A DOT physical exam is valid for up to 24 months. The medical examiner may also issue a medical examiner’s certificate for less than 24 months when it is desirable to monitor a condition, such as high blood pressure.

What is DOT physical certification?

A DOT physical is a checkup that’s required for commercial vehicle drivers by the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A). This exam makes sure you’re able to meet the physical requirements of your job. This includes being able to tolerate the health risks posed by sitting for long periods of time.

What should I expect in a dot physical exam?

What to expect during the DOT exam: The medical examiner will perform a full physical, which includes: Examination of the eyes, ears, mouth, and throat. Listening to heart and lungs. A hernia check. A check for spine deformities. Pressing on abdomen to check for abnormalities.

What are the requirements for DOT medical exam?

Health Requirements. The basic requirements for passing a DOT physical exam are: With or without vision corrections, each eye, as well as both eyes combined, need to have 20/40 vision. Ability to distinguish color is necessary. Hearing needs to be good enough to notice a forced whisper at a minimum distance of 5 feet.
